The word detox gets thrown around a lot. It usually brings to mind expensive juice cleanses, restrictive diets, or questionable teas promising a quick fix.
But here’s the truth: your body already has the most powerful detoxification system in the world, working for you 24/7. Your liver, kidneys, gut, skin, and lymphatic system are constantly processing and eliminating toxins.
The real key to feeling clean, energised, and healthy isn’t a short-term, punishing “detox” – it’s about consistently supporting these natural systems.
Let’s forget the fads and talk about how detoxification really works.
Meet Your Body’s Built-In Detox Team
True detoxification is a daily process managed by a team of incredible organs:
The Liver – Your body’s main filter, converting toxins into water-soluble compounds for excretion.
The Kidneys – Constantly filter your blood and flush waste via urine.
The Gut – Eliminates solid waste and prevents toxins from leaking into your blood.
The Skin – Removes toxins through sweat.
The Lymphatic System – Acts as your drainage network, clearing waste from tissues.
Instead of overriding this system with fad diets, the goal is to support it with the right tools.
Simple Ways to Support Your Natural Detox Systems
Support Your Liver
Your liver works hard daily—so give it extra support.
✅ Eat cruciferous veg: broccoli, kale, Brussels sprouts.
✅ Add garlic, onions, turmeric, and milk thistle for liver protection.
🚫 Limit alcohol, processed foods, and inflammatory oils.
Support Your Kidneys & Hydration
Your kidneys rely on water to filter waste efficiently.
✅ Drink 2–3L of filtered water daily.
✅ Add a pinch of unrefined sea salt to improve hydration.
✅ Try nettle or dandelion tea for gentle kidney support.
Support Your Gut
Your digestive system needs fibre and healthy bacteria.
✅ Add fibre from oats, beans, vegetables, and nuts.
✅ Include probiotic foods like kefir, natural yoghurt, and sauerkraut.
Support Your Skin & Lymphatic System
Movement is key here.
✅ Sweat through exercise, saunas, or steam rooms.
✅ Dry brush before showers to stimulate lymph flow.
Lifestyle Habits for Daily Detox
✅ Prioritise sleep – Your brain’s glymphatic system cleans house while you rest.
✅ Manage stress – Chronic stress weakens detox pathways. Breathing, dhikr, and walks in nature help calm the nervous system.
